Season 4

Don Cheadle returns as Marty Kaan in the fourth season of House of Lies. We last left a despondent Marty alone in the desert after a cataclysmic double-cross by Jeannie (Kristen Bell) and a visit by the Feds.

This season, Marty's brief stint in white collar prison left Jeannie to pick up the pieces of the now tainted Kaan & Associates with Clyde (Ben Schwartz) and Doug (Josh Lawson). Client flight decimated the bottom line, but Marty is a singular focus: winning, at any and all cost.

Larenz Tate (Rush) returns as Marty's brother Malcolm along with new guest stars Demetri Martin (The Daily Show with John Stewart) and Valorie Curry (The Following).

Also guest starring this season are Mary McCormack (In Plain Sight) as Denna Altshuler, a tough, highly successful white knight investor who Marty recruits to help save Kaan & Associates; Alicia Witt (Justified) as Maya Lindholm, a brilliant engineer who comes to Marty's rescue when he's in a bind; and Steven Weber as Ray Montinola, a turnaround specialist who jumps in to assist Marty and the Pod.

From the hit tell-all book House of Lies: How Management Consultants Steal Your Watch and Tell You the Time by Martin Kihn, House of Lies stars Cheadle in his three-time Emmy-nominated and Golden Globe-winning performance.

Kristen Bell plays his razor-sharp partner, along with Emmy winner Ben Schwartz, Josh Lawson, Emmy winner Glynn Turman and Donis Leonard Jr.

Produced by Showtime, House of Lies is created and executive produced by Matthew Carnahan. Jessika Borsiczky, Don Cheadle and David Walpert return as executive producers for Season 4.
